Head of Learning and Development UK Gigafactory HR
UK Gigafactory, Bridgwater, Somerset Initially, this will be a homebased role with regular travel our head office based in Warwick in line with business requirements. This role will transition into a full time, office based role when an office space is ready in Somerset.
About Agratas:
Agratas is a wholly owned subsidiary of Tata Sons. We are rapidly scaling up our operations to pioneer the design, development, and manufacturing of high-quality, high-performance, sustainable batteries for electric vehicles (EVs) at our state-of-the-art gigafactory in the UK.
The Role:
The Head of Learning and Development will be responsible for the planning, development, and successful delivery of an organisational programme of core, specialist and professional learning and development initiatives that meet operational and regulatory requirements to ensure that all colleagues are suitably qualified, competent and skilled to undertake their roles. The role will report to the VP HR, UK Gigafactory, with a dotted line to the VP Talent Management and matrix of stakeholders including the VP UK Manufacturing and CHRO.
They will create and lead a high-performance Learning and Development team responsible for the implementation of agreed strategic objectives, on time and on budget in a fast paced operational environment. The overriding goal of the Head of Learning & Development is to help Agratas meet its targets through an in-depth training and development programme.
The role will also take the lead on partnerships with education providers and government agencies, helping Agratas secure funding and the facilities to train large numbers of workers, as well as working with external and internal resources to design fit for purpose training programmes.
Key Responsibilities:
Build effective, collaborative working relationships with relevant senior leadership representatives, Gigafactory leaders, HR teams and subject matter experts to understand and continually re-evaluate organisational learning and development needs to ensure they are aligned with business need and current regulatory and legislative requirements.
Develop and oversee the delivery of an agreed learning and development strategy, in conjunction with the VP HR, UK Gigafactory, and VP Talent Management, Gigafactory Senior Leadership and other internal stakeholders, which meets the short, medium and long-term aims of the organisation.
Project manage the development, design and creation of training materials from a "blank sheet" to deliver mandatory, leadership and developmental training.
Lead and coach the Learning and Development team to ensure it is high-performing and value adding through effective recruitment, induction, training, development, performance management and leadership of all members of the team.
Develop, implement and lead a far-reaching apprenticeship and early careers program to secure a continuous flow of talent into the Gigafactory to ensure we meet our growth plans. To facilitate this, partner with local and national education providers and stakeholders to develop a skills pipeline and secure suitable funding.
Foster a culture of continuous improvement within the Learning & Development function to ensure processes and practices are continually reviewed and lessons learned lead to change and best practice.
Maintain an internal and external focus, horizon scanning and networking to explore and identify the most effective and innovative training, learning and delivery initiatives and projects to ensure that Agratas is a sector-leader in respect of career and professional development.
Build and create robust methods for tracking, reporting, evaluating and analysing performance of the Learning & Development function and the effectiveness of the programme it delivers.
Person Specification:
Significant prior experience working as a Senior Learning & Development Manager.
Previous experience in an equivalent industry (manufacturing, FMCG, Automotive, Aerospace etc).
Prior experience with apprenticeship, early careers and associated funding channels.
Experience in project management, budgeting and vendor management.
Practical experience with e-learning platforms and Learning Management Systems (LMS).
Experience in change management.
Excellent communication skills with the ability to communicate at all levels.
Highly organised with the ability to prioritise and manage numerous projects with competing priorities.
Strong stakeholder management and influencing skills
Relevant HR qualification or L&D Certification (CIPD, CPLP, CPTD) or equivalent experience.
At Agratas, we strongly believe that people are at their best when they feel supported and happy in their workplace. To that end we continue to cultivate a diverse workforce which protects the individuality of each employee. We therefore warmly welcome applicants from any race, gender, sexuality, and ability.
